The phylogenetic trees of the insect chemosensory proteins (CSPs) gene from 59 sequences of CSPs in 23 species under 7 orders published in GeneBank were generated by MEGA 5.0. Complete comparisons of CSPs sequences were used to determine the rates of synonymous(Ks) and nonsynonymous(Kn) codon substitutions and the ratio of Kn/Ks was calculated to estimate of the selection pressure on CSPs genes in insects.The Kn/Ks ratio was far less than 1,suggesting that CSPs may be evolving under negative selection.By the site-specific model in PAML 4.4, 6 amino acid sites undergoing positive selection were detected,5 of them were in the important function regions.
